What Does Body Mass Index Mean?

Body Mass Index (BMI) is a numerical value that compares your body weight with your height. It gives a basic idea of whether your weight is balanced for your body structure.

BMI does not involve medical tests or scans. Doctors often use it as an initial health screening tool before further evaluation.

BMI for Children and Teenagers

For children and teenagers aged 2 to 20, BMI works differently. It is measured using age- and gender-based percentiles instead of fixed numbers.

BMI Percentile Meaning
Below 5th Underweight
5th – 84th Healthy Weight
85th – 94th Overweight
95th and above Obese

Health Risks of High BMI

Having a high BMI for a long time can increase health risks. Excess weight may put pressure on the heart, joints, and lungs, making daily activities difficult.

Common risks include heart disease, high blood pressure, diabetes, joint pain, and low energy.

Health Risks of Low BMI

Being underweight can also cause health issues. A very low BMI may lead to weakness, fatigue, frequent illness, and poor immunity.

Maintaining a healthy BMI supports overall strength and wellness.

Limitations of BMI

BMI does not measure body fat, muscle mass, or bone density. Athletes or muscular individuals may have a high BMI even if they are healthy.

BMI should always be used as a general health awareness tool, not a medical diagnosis.
